During review of the Pictavo thumbnail pipeline, we found that the queue worker dequeues render jobs without re-validating the source object path against the tenant allowlist. A crafted job payload could cause the worker to read objects outside the submitting tenant's namespace. No evidence of exploitation in the audit logs to date. Fix enforces allowlist checks at dequeue time, with rejected jobs routed to quarantine. The vulnerable behavior was introduced in the build recorded below.

build token for kagaf-hahof: htk14_9d3d4d26d7d8de

## Who to Ping — Spoolhaven

Welcome! Spoolhaven is our little printer-spooler microservice — scrappy but load-bearing. Day-to-day questions go in the team channel; the Inkline crew is quick to respond. Stuck jobs usually clear themselves in five minutes, so don't panic early. For anything gnarlier, like queue corruption or deploy issues, send a message to the address below.

pager mailbox: silael.sorwyn.tamius@zemvarsys.corp

**Vendor note: Inkmill markdown pipeline**

Rendering for Parchway docs is outsourced to Inkmill under an annual contract, renewing each March. They handle sanitization and PDF export; we own the upload queue. SLA: 4-hour response on rendering failures. Escalate only after two failed retries. Their support desk is reachable at the address below.

billing contact of hahaf-baguf = zorael.tammir.jorius@sivrelhq.internal

Handover note — Veldora expansion

From: Director Maren Oquist
To: Director Talan Brue

Sales leads: read in full. Veldora region launch moves to Talan effective Monday. Pipeline sits at 41 qualified accounts, mostly mid-market logistics. Local distributor talks with Korvane Freight stalled; revive or cut by month end. Pricing sheet for the Arbello tier is final — no discounting without sign-off. Staffing requests go through Talan now. The strategic rationale for sequencing is summarised below.

board note of bawep-tajef: Queniusek Systems plans to raise the Quenvan list price by 53.1 percent in March. The pricing group signed off on a budget of $176.4 million for Project Drueth. The renewal with Casionix Partners closes at $142.5 million a year, 8.3 percent below the last contract. Project Fraax slips by six weeks because of the tooling delay.